Baby Moses Basket
Traditionally made from wicker or natural reed but they can also be made from hyacinth, willow or palm. All are natural materials that allows air to circulate around and through the basket making sure that baby has good ventilation and at the same time has a safe and nurturing environment in which they feel comfortable enough to sleep in.

A baby bassinet or basket is an essential piece of nursery furniture for parents with a new baby. However whilst they are popular due to their low cost and proven track record they are not mandatory. These days there are many more options for finding somewhere for baby to sleep from a crib in a nursery room to a bedside baby moses basket with stand.
Having your baby close, next to your bed is not only convenient but also reassuring for both parents and baby.
The NHS says that for the first few months, you'll need a crib, carrycot or Moses basket (a light, portable bassinet). Your baby needs to sleep somewhere that's safe, warm and not too far from you. Baby nests are not suitable for your baby to sleep in when you're not there because of the danger of suffocation.

Your baby can sleep in a cot from birth. A crib or Moses basket is not necessary if space is tight, or your budget is limited.

Moses baskets should be set down on the floor, on a flat, not raised surface - unless you have a Moses basket stand. - which.co.uk

Ideally, for the first six months, your baby will sleep in their Moses basket or cot in the same room as you even for their daytime naps . ... If your baby is very young, don't let them sleep in their car seat for more than 90 minutes. - nct.org.uk
